Understanding Contested Divorce Laws in South Tempe
Navigating a contested divorce in South Tempe requires a comprehensive understanding of Arizona’s family law statutes and local court procedures. Under Arizona law, contested divorces arise when spouses cannot agree on key issues such as child custody, property division, or spousal support. In South Tempe, local regulations ensure that both parties have the opportunity to present their cases before a judge, whose decisions are guided by the best interests of any children involved and equitable distribution of assets. The court process often involves multiple hearings, exchanges of financial disclosures, and negotiations—sometimes requiring mediation before matters are resolved at trial. Potential penalties or resolutions can vary, ranging from temporary support orders during the proceedings to final decrees on custody or division of marital property.

South Tempe Family Court System
South Tempe falls under the jurisdiction of Maricopa County for family law matters. The family court system is designed to address a broad range of domestic relations issues, ensuring accessibility and support for families throughout the legal process.
- Main Courts: The Maricopa County Superior Court – Southeast Facility, located in Mesa, is the primary venue for South Tempe family law cases. Some cases may be referred to the Downtown Phoenix courthouse, depending on case complexity and judicial assignments.
- Case Types: The court handles:
- Dissolutions of marriage (divorce) and legal separation
- Child custody and parenting time
- Child and spousal support (maintenance)
- Paternity establishment
- Adoptions and parental rights terminations
- Orders of protection against domestic violence
- Modifications and enforcement of existing family law orders
- Unique Features:
- Family Court Services offer mediation, parenting conferences, custody evaluations, and special support programs to guide parties toward resolution and protect children’s interests.
- The court provides resources for self-represented litigants and encourages alternative dispute resolution where appropriate.
- Electronic case filing, online document access, and virtual hearings are all available, enhancing convenience and transparency for South Tempe residents.
South Tempe Family Law Statistics
- Divorce Rates: Maricopa County—covering South Tempe—reports a consistent divorce rate of approximately 3.3 to 3.5 divorces per 1,000 married individuals per year, similar to state averages. South Tempe’s demographic of established families may translate to slightly lower rates than the county average, though comprehensive sub-regional statistics are not published.
- Child Custody Cases: Most custody cases in South Tempe result in shared legal decision-making (joint custody), reflecting statewide and county policies favoring co-parenting, except where circumstances suggest otherwise (such as abuse or neglect).
- Trends: There is an increasing reliance on mediation and parenting coordination to resolve disputes amicably, and the courts continue to emphasize child-centered approaches and early resolution.
- Child Welfare Initiatives:
- Parents are required to complete mandatory parenting education programs during custody and divorce proceedings, focusing on minimizing adverse effects on children.
- Specialized services such as supervised visitation and forensic evaluations are provided when necessary to ensure child safety and well-being.
- Types of Cases: Routine family law matters in South Tempe include divorces with property division, modifications to custody and support arrangements, enforcement actions, and grandparent visitation rights.
